Welcome to Gaia! :: View User's Journal | Gaia Journals

 
 

View User's Journal

Gaia Life
A catalog of my experiences as an employee and citizen of Gaia.
The Harder They Come
Yeah, it's been a long time since I did a journal update, and a lot has happened in that period on Gaia. I've been super busy with a number of different projects, one of which you'll get to see in a bit - small as it is.

I hit an unprecedented 4 projects in QA at one point there. QA, short for "Quality Assurance", is where we internally test features before they go live on the site to make sure they're not buggy and that they make sense. So basically what that meant for me is that I had 4 projects that I was building/fixing/testing all at once.

I might as well tell you guys what they all were:

Easter / April Fools 2008 "Events"
This was a small one and many of you have seen what I had to say on the subject. For those of you who haven't, check these out:

http://www.gaiaonline.com/forum/t.39144505_128/#128
Quote:
I do feel as though this could have been avoided, and many of us saw this coming and wanted to do things differently -- but it takes a LOT of people to pull an event together, including artists, developers, writers, user-interface people, and the managers that keep everybody from these different departments working together smoothly. Project as big as events (which need to be turned around VERY quickly, relative to any other project we do) are hard to course-correct. The real issue is that we didn't have the right course to begin with, and there are more than a few of us who want to see that changed.


The good news is that as a result, we are planning some kickass events for later in the year (and yes, they'll be big and filled with storyline, unless something awful happens). As always, of course, things are subject to change outside of my control -- but if things stay on the track they are now, I think Gaians are going to be looking forward to an excellent event season.

Notice System
This is a system similar to our announcement system, except instead of going to EVERY user on the site, we can choose a subset of users to deliver the notice to. It's an alternative to using the PM system, which we can't use for mass-notifications. Some possible applications of this:


  • If a subset of users fell prey to a bug, we could notify them directly with a link to a thread on the subject

  • We did something like this for The Last Mimzy, but for any user that participated in a particular sponsorship, we could poll them directly after the sponsorship ended to see what they thought of something

  • If we want to survey a subset of users (e.g., users who registered on a particular day, users who used a particular feature, etc.) we could deliver surveys directly to them via the word bubble at the top


Quiz System Upgrade
This basically now allows us to use the Quiz System (previously used for the 4th Anniversary Event and several sponsorships) to do polls. Before, the quiz system just calculated a score and stored that score. Now, it will actually store responses that you choose, and will allow you to enter in text fields.

On top of that, since we added text fields to support questionnaires, we can now also ask for text responses on regular quizzes. For example, we could ask "What is the name of Ian's cat?" and instead of giving you multiple choice answers, we could instead have you just enter the name of his cat into a text box - which opens some interesting possibilities for the future.

We'll probably use this along with the Notice System, as mentioned before, to survey some users after sponsorships. This may seem like a nuisance at first, but it enables us to make our sponsorships better, in addition to allowing us to see how successful they are in informing users about our sponsors' products. This is good for Gaia, because if we can show sponsors that what we're doing works, we'll get better and better sponsorships going forward.

Quest System Upgrade: So finally this project is almost ready for release. I mentioned it at Wondercon, and it's been in a holding pattern for a long time. The short version of everything that's happening here:


  • A new, storyline-based, Gaia-specific quest involving multiple NPCs that results in a quest-only item (no, still not the longer-term backwings quest -- but these changes may enable that)

  • Lots of changes that fix longstanding problems with the Quest System, many of which will make creating new quests much easier.

  • Completely rewritten Quest Status page


    • Updated appearance

    • built-in support for Battle Quests when they come out

    • The Quest Status page will now actually update with no lag

    • You can delete quests that are expired/deleted from your quest log

    • From the Quest Status page, you'll be able to jump right to an NPC.

    • Each quest and quest step will now have a unique description, so the information in the quest status page will be much more useful and interesting

    • You can search quests by NPC and location (useful especially since eventually you may be on dozens of quests at a time)

    • Pagination for multiple pages of quests

    • Active quests and completed quests have been totally separated

    • You can now view a log of all the steps you've completed on a quest

    • "Freshest" quests (i.e., the most recently updated/added ones) will now appear at the top of the log


  • Updated NPC quest behavior in shops:


    • NPCs in shops will no longer bug you for expired/deleted quests

    • Quests no longer become unfinishable in shops when we do caroling or trick-or-treating.

    • We can now jump directly to quest NPCs in a shop that has multiple NPCs

    • When an NPC requires you to purchase something for a quest, the quest dialog will now appear immediately after the "You bought [item] for XX gold" dialog bubble

    • There will be a new "Quest Update!" button in shops whenever an NPC has quest dialog for you


  • Each NPC is now associated with a location on the site

  • Lots of other changes to support battle quests when battle is released

  • We can now have multiple NPCs reacting to a quest step (i.e., Rina could send you to give an item to Josie, and they would both continue to talk about the quest)

  • About 40-or-so other changes not worth mentioning because they happen on the backend or in the admin tools


The High Cost of Living
A lot of users have a lot of questions about the finances of Gaia, and CEO Craig was kind of enough to be clear on Gaia's costs. You can find details about all this stuff here - definitely worth reading!

Gaia Costs $25 Million Per Year

I'm late! I'm late! I'm late, I'm late, I'm late!

There's never enough time to talk about everything that's been going on, but I'll try to keep you guys posted whenever I have free moments!






User Comments: [37] [add]
Sgt.PepperHat
Community Member
avatar
commentCommented on: Thu Apr 03, 2008 @ 11:39pm
-steal-
The Quiz System Update sounds pretty cool.
Unless you guys start asking really tough questions. D:
Then it won't be as cool.

Looks like you've been pretty busy with updating features.
I'm highly looking forward to the Quest.
And of course future Events.
I must start thinking of crazy plot theories for hilarity to ensue.

And of course; better late than never!
: DD <3


commentCommented on: Thu Apr 03, 2008 @ 11:43pm
Oh I'm so glad to hear about the quests with NPCs in shops will no longer bug us I found it very annoying.Can't wait for the new quests .



MrsrachaelSnape
Community Member
Leena no Majo
Community Member
avatar
commentCommented on: Thu Apr 03, 2008 @ 11:43pm
I am squeeing with happiness at all the updates.

I can't wait to see all the new quests that can come about because of the changes. ^.^

Don't worry about rushing to get your journal updated, it just means that when they finally do update they're that much more awesome biggrin


commentCommented on: Thu Apr 03, 2008 @ 11:47pm
HOLY CRAP AN UPDATE!

EDIT: Lots of them, apparently. Thanks for all the hard work, Fleep!



dBEf-GAEc-18E-BBAf
Community Member
AriRashkae
Community Member
avatar
commentCommented on: Fri Apr 04, 2008 @ 12:07am
w00t! Upgraded quests! The rpg-gamer in me is swooning. heart


commentCommented on: Fri Apr 04, 2008 @ 12:32am
Thanks for the journal update Fleep.



Sheshira
Community Member
Tai Naito
Community Member
avatar
commentCommented on: Fri Apr 04, 2008 @ 12:36am
I'm glad you give us updates on what you guys are working on that we can't see smile


commentCommented on: Fri Apr 04, 2008 @ 12:41am
Sweet! Quest System update! I'm really excited now. XD



Cube B
Community Member
Darkfreakoid
Community Member
avatar
commentCommented on: Fri Apr 04, 2008 @ 12:41am
Wow, that's a crapload of improvements for Quests, and I thank you and everyone else involved for making them! Sounds like it'll be smoother, and the best thing is that it means making quests won't take as long correct? Sweet. ^^

Thanks for taking the time to tell us this stuff, I'm sure it took you awhile to write it all out.


commentCommented on: Fri Apr 04, 2008 @ 12:52am
Woah you had a lot on your hands



Beyawnce
Community Member
Inti Castro
Community Member
avatar
commentCommented on: Fri Apr 04, 2008 @ 01:11am
Let's all just forget about Easter. It seems there are brighter things ahead of us. =)


commentCommented on: Fri Apr 04, 2008 @ 01:14am
good to hear from you fleep. and i cant wait for the quest system



The anti-social cookie
Community Member
User 8628682
Community Member
avatar
commentCommented on: Fri Apr 04, 2008 @ 01:40am
I wanna be with you

Thank you so much for telling us all this fleepy. And that article on how much gaia spends a year was most informative. >< I'm gonna try and donate as soon as I can.


Do dreams come true?


commentCommented on: Fri Apr 04, 2008 @ 02:14am
Thanks for the info <3 We appreciate it! Glad to hear about the new events/upcoming events! ^^ Very exciting!



Lady Kayura
Community Member
Riddle-Me-This
Community Member
avatar
commentCommented on: Fri Apr 04, 2008 @ 02:34am
ILU heart <3


commentCommented on: Fri Apr 04, 2008 @ 03:11am
Glad to see you alive n kickin' Fleep!! I gotta say just reading your entry wore me out,so I can only imagine how tuckered ya'all are there. xd We really do appreciate all the hard work and creativity you and your co-workers put into Gaia. Keep up the brilliant work! Oh and maybe get a lil snooze in now and then. wink xx



ladywolf
Community Member
hwip
Community Member
avatar
commentCommented on: Fri Apr 04, 2008 @ 03:15am
O_O
Thanks for updating us on things that you guys are working on. Looks like you devs have been busy.


commentCommented on: Fri Apr 04, 2008 @ 03:29am
THANK GOD!! Edmund has been bugging me for items since Halloween. crying And I still have the 2nd Mimzy quest stuck in my quest log. >.<; Good to hear we can remove them.

I'm extremely pleased to hear that there will be a NPC quest with a quest only item. I can't wait to start it, finish it and read people in SF bitching/luffing it. rofl

The Quiz system update sounds great too. I can't wait to see what you guys decided to do with it. And the I can see how the Notification update can help. I still remember the Mimzy one. ninja



Ginger Flare
Community Member
Cid High-Wind
Community Member
avatar
commentCommented on: Fri Apr 04, 2008 @ 05:47am
Thanks for the update, Fleep!


commentCommented on: Fri Apr 04, 2008 @ 07:40am
Thank you kind sir for a lovely tea-party.



Spirrow
Community Member
Divine will
Community Member
avatar
commentCommented on: Fri Apr 04, 2008 @ 09:19am
Oh man, I can't wait till all those new quests come out, and its nice to hear I won't be hit by a wall of text every time I go to HR Wesley blaugh


commentCommented on: Fri Apr 04, 2008 @ 01:38pm
Hooray, an update! blaugh Thanks for taking the time for this, Fleep. A lot of us really do love to get the insider's perspective on what it's like at Gaia. And today's insight is: BUSY! Wow, what a lot you've all been working on; keep it up.

Yes, let's just forget about Easter this year and focus on future good things. I hope Easter will return to Gaia's event calendar for next year, though, as it has been a fan favorite.

Ooo, you speak of multiple events; I wonder if there's one for the Summer Olympics...? whee And there will be plot updates, too~! 4laugh I'm so happy to hear that!

Thanks for giving us a way to kill dead quests, too; that Bee Movie quest has been an eyesore for a ton of Gaians, but it won't be anymore. blaugh



Chocobo Princess
Global Moderator
AlexDitto
Community Member
avatar
commentCommented on: Fri Apr 04, 2008 @ 01:47pm
Woo! An update! Thanks for taking time out of your busy schedule to tell us what you've been working on... it all seems so exciting!

The Quiz system has me excited (MATH QUIZZES MAYBE? YAY!), but I'm probably happiest to hear about the Quest system upgrade. It's been so neglected recently, I think this will breathe some life into it. Also Edmund will stop asking me for Garlic. Thank goodness. razz


commentCommented on: Fri Apr 04, 2008 @ 02:59pm
ninja Got a brand new shipment of electrical equipment...

I am super excited for the next stage in Quests.
It has been awhile since those infamous "two Gaian-only quests" from last year, so I am pumped to see progress! ^__^x
And from the sounds of it, they will be kickass!


...it's addressed to the bottom of the sea. domokun



jfnbhgurkddhj8
Community Member
Lyca_Watyre
Community Member
avatar
commentCommented on: Fri Apr 04, 2008 @ 06:37pm
Woot! I'm really excited about all the new stuff! The notice system sounds very handy. I can't wait to see it in action.

Now we can make the little voices stop following me! ((I can never complete the quests involving cinemas and those NPCs are buggering me about it))

We're very hungry for more plot infused events. Easter and April Fools left me feeling empty and lost, though I love the Egg.


commentCommented on: Fri Apr 04, 2008 @ 06:42pm
I'm glad to see transparency in the details of how some of this stuff gets updated or runs in the first place. It makes you devs a lot less faceless and I feel better knowing things are going on behind the scenes.



Indoras
Community Member
Yen Quest
Community Member
avatar
commentCommented on: Fri Apr 04, 2008 @ 10:06pm
Oh gee Fleep, if you're late to something, don't bother writing long sentences. I'm used to waiting and getting vague info. xd Hope that everything is well at your side.

Even though I don't like doing surveys (because I get wordy and go off path at times), the reason for having the quiz feature is good/reasonable. There's bad apples out there, so don't be surprised that you don't get good constructive feedback. ^^;

Can't wait to see what you've been working on for the past few months. Thankyou so much for working so hard on one feature. Wish I could say more than just that though, but oh well. At least you know that there are people out there who cares about your health and appreciate what you do for them, right? 3nodding


commentCommented on: Sat Apr 05, 2008 @ 12:55am
It's always nice reading your journals, Fleep. You keep us so informed. ^.^ Anyway, happy to see so many upgrades to the quest system. Even happier to know I won't have Edmund asking me to buy anymore of those black orchids. xd Thanks.



iMWorkingHard
Community Member
Wolfram Cecilia Ysud
Community Member
avatar
commentCommented on: Sat Apr 05, 2008 @ 05:14am
Well, i'm sure QA will do an excellent job with refining these projects.


commentCommented on: Sat Apr 05, 2008 @ 08:33pm
Glad to hear that you are still alive and kicken. I bet that it's hard to keep up with things at times. ANyhow, have a good one and take care.....



rainbowrider
Community Member
ZoneIV
Community Member
avatar
commentCommented on: Sun Apr 06, 2008 @ 03:25am
To make work more enjoyable, I think you need to listen to some 80s power pop/rock to increase your motivation and let you slip into a work Montage.


commentCommented on: Sun Apr 06, 2008 @ 07:01am
Oh Fleep, I do hope things work out and something awful doesn't happen. I'm looking forward to the event, it always gets the community together. I really enjoyed the summer and Halloween events last year. Keep up the good work and good luck to the crew that is fighting to keep Gaia the real Gaia.

Best wishes,
Skittles



Cosmic Remnant
Community Member
wtf its kae
Community Member
avatar
commentCommented on: Mon Apr 07, 2008 @ 04:24pm
Thank you for the update, Fleep.
As always, you have your finger on the pulse of the Gaian Community. 3nodding


commentCommented on: Tue Apr 08, 2008 @ 02:42am
Cool! All this stuff sounds pretty neat Fleep, thanks for keeping us updated! 3nodding heart

I'm particularly excited about the quest system, but I do have a question/request. The grand majority of our quests so far have taken place in cinemas, which though I've tried very, very hard to fix, still don't work on my computer (I get the 'town server' error, no matter how few people are in the cinemas I choose, what time of day I try, or how many users are online).

My point is that I'm not the only one that has this problem, by a long shot. I guess what I'm trying to say is that unless there's a problem with the system we don't know about, a great many of us are hoping we aren't required to go through cinemas to do these fun new quests coming out. Really, I'd love more than anything to participate, but they just don't work! You wouldn't even BELIEVE how much I loved the quiz-based quests! sweatdrop crying

Keep up the great work Fleep, know we appreciate it very much! heart 3nodding



Kai-Shan Valandria
Community Member
Choclat
Community Member
avatar
commentCommented on: Thu Apr 10, 2008 @ 11:02pm
Thanks for the information Fleep!


commentCommented on: Sat Apr 19, 2008 @ 01:21am
Wow! That sounds like a lot of stress! We love you fleep! Keep going strong! The GR loves ya!



Karo Kiba
Community Member
NLSGUNS
Community Member
avatar
commentCommented on: Mon Aug 18, 2008 @ 07:28pm
I read Q&A as in Question and Answer instead of QA. : P


User Comments: [37] [add]
 
 
Manage Your Items
Other Stuff
Get GCash
Offers
Get Items
More Items
Where Everyone Hangs Out
Other Community Areas
Virtual Spaces
Fun Stuff
Gaia's Games
Mini-Games
Play with GCash
Play with Platinum